// Copyright 2019-2022 Graham Clark. All rights reserved.  Use of this source code is governed by the MIT license
// that can be found in the LICENSE file.

// A port of urwid's palette_test.py example using gowid widgets.
package main

import (
	"errors"
	"os"
	"regexp"
	"strings"

	"github.com/gcla/gowid"
	"github.com/gcla/gowid/examples"
	"github.com/gcla/gowid/widgets/button"
	"github.com/gcla/gowid/widgets/columns"
	"github.com/gcla/gowid/widgets/divider"
	"github.com/gcla/gowid/widgets/holder"
	"github.com/gcla/gowid/widgets/pile"
	"github.com/gcla/gowid/widgets/radio"
	"github.com/gcla/gowid/widgets/styled"
	"github.com/gcla/gowid/widgets/text"
	tcell "github.com/gdamore/tcell/v2"
	log "github.com/sirupsen/logrus"
)

var attrRE = regexp.MustCompile(`(?P<whitespace>[ \n]*)(?P<entry>((#...)|([a-z_]{2,})|(g[0-9]+_+)|(t[0-9]{1,3})))`)

var attrREIndices = makeRegexpNameMap(attrRE)

var fgColorDefault = gowid.NewUrwidColor("light gray")
var bgColorDefault = gowid.MakeTCellColorExt(tcell.ColorBlack)

var chartHolder *holder.Widget

var chart256Content *text.Widget
var chart88Content *text.Widget
var chart16Content *text.Widget
var chart8Content *text.Widget
var chartMonoContent *text.Widget

var foregroundColors = true

//======================================================================

func makeRegexpNameMap(re *regexp.Regexp) map[string]int {
	res := make(map[string]int)
	for i, name := range re.SubexpNames() {
		res[name] = i
	}
	return res
}

//======================================================================

func updateChartHolder(mode gowid.ColorMode, app gowid.IApp) {
	switch mode {
	case gowid.Mode256Colors:
		chart256Content = text.NewFromContent(parseChart(chart256))
		chartHolder.SetSubWidget(chart256Content, app)
	case gowid.Mode88Colors:
		chart88Content = text.NewFromContent(parseChart(chart88))
		chartHolder.SetSubWidget(chart88Content, app)
	case gowid.Mode16Colors:
		chart16Content = text.NewFromContent(parseChart(chart16))
		chartHolder.SetSubWidget(chart16Content, app)
	case gowid.Mode8Colors:
		chart8Content = text.NewFromContent(parseChart(chart8))
		chartHolder.SetSubWidget(chart8Content, app)
	case gowid.ModeMonochrome:
		chartMonoContent = text.NewFromContent(parseChart(chartMono))
		chartHolder.SetSubWidget(chartMonoContent, app)
	default:
		panic(errors.New("Invalid mode, something went wrong!"))
	}
}

//======================================================================

func modeRb(group *[]radio.IWidget, txt string) gowid.IWidget {
	rbt := text.New(" " + txt)
	rb := radio.New(group)
	widp := gowid.RenderFixed{}

	rb.OnClick(gowid.WidgetCallback{"cb", func(app gowid.IApp, w gowid.IWidget) {
		if rb.Selected {
			switch txt {
			case "256-Color":
				app.SetColorMode(gowid.Mode256Colors)
			case "88-Color":
				app.SetColorMode(gowid.Mode88Colors)
			case "16-Color":
				app.SetColorMode(gowid.Mode16Colors)
			case "8-Color":
				app.SetColorMode(gowid.Mode8Colors)
			case "Monochrome":
				app.SetColorMode(gowid.ModeMonochrome)
			case "Foreground Colors":
				foregroundColors = true
			case "Background Colors":
				foregroundColors = false
			default:
				panic(errors.New("Invalid mode, something went wrong!"))
			}
			updateChartHolder(app.GetColorMode(), app) // Update the chart displayed
		}
	}})

	c := columns.New([]gowid.IContainerWidget{
		&gowid.ContainerWidget{rb, widp},
		&gowid.ContainerWidget{rbt, widp},
	})

	cm := styled.NewExt(c, gowid.MakePaletteRef("panel"), gowid.MakePaletteRef("focus"))

	return cm
}

//======================================================================

func parseChart(chart string) *text.Content {
	content := make([]text.ContentSegment, 0)
	replacer := strings.NewReplacer("_", " ")
	for _, match := range attrRE.FindAllStringSubmatch(chart, -1) {
		ws := match[attrREIndices["whitespace"]]
		if ws != "" {
			content = append(content, text.StringContent(ws))
		}
		entry := match[attrREIndices["entry"]]
		entry = replacer.Replace(entry)

		entry2 := strings.Trim(entry, " ")
		scol, err := gowid.MakeColorSafe(entry2)
		if err == nil {
			var attrPair gowid.PaletteEntry
			if foregroundColors {
				attrPair = gowid.MakePaletteEntry(scol, bgColorDefault)
			} else {
				attrPair = gowid.MakePaletteEntry(fgColorDefault, scol)
			}
			content = append(content, text.StyledContent(entry, attrPair))
		} else {
			content = append(content, text.StyledContent(entry, gowid.MakePaletteRef("redinv")))
		}
	}
	return text.NewContent(content)
}

//======================================================================

func main() {

	// If this is set to truecolor when a gowid screen is setup, 24-bit truecolor
	// support is enabled. Then the program won't output the 256-color/16-color
	// terminal codes that this program is supposed to exhibit. So unset the variable
	// right away.
	os.Unsetenv("COLORTERM")

	f := examples.RedirectLogger("palette.log")
	defer f.Close()

	palette := gowid.Palette{
		"header":  gowid.MakeStyledPaletteEntry(gowid.ColorBlack, gowid.ColorWhite, gowid.StyleUnderline),
		"panel":   gowid.MakePaletteEntry(gowid.ColorWhite, gowid.ColorDarkBlue),
		"focus":   gowid.MakePaletteEntry(gowid.ColorYellow, gowid.ColorRed),
		"red":     gowid.MakePaletteEntry(gowid.ColorRed, gowid.ColorBlack),
		"redinv":  gowid.MakePaletteEntry(gowid.ColorBlack, gowid.ColorRed),
		"default": gowid.MakePaletteEntry(gowid.NewUrwidColor("light gray"), gowid.ColorBlack),
	}

	header := gowid.MakePaletteRef("header")

	// make this just text
	headerContent := []text.ContentSegment{
		text.StyledContent("Gowid Palette Test", header),
	}

	headerText := styled.New(text.NewFromContent(text.NewContent(headerContent)), header)

	rbgroup := make([]radio.IWidget, 0)
	bggroup := make([]radio.IWidget, 0)

	btn := button.New(text.New("Exit"))

	btn.OnClick(gowid.WidgetCallback{"cb", func(app gowid.IApp, w gowid.IWidget) {
		app.Quit()
	}})

	subFlow := gowid.RenderFlow{}

	// Put this in the group first so it is the one selected
	cols256 := modeRb(&rbgroup, "256-Color")

	pw1 := pile.New([]gowid.IContainerWidget{
		&gowid.ContainerWidget{modeRb(&rbgroup, "Monochrome"), subFlow},
		&gowid.ContainerWidget{modeRb(&rbgroup, "8-Color"), subFlow},
		&gowid.ContainerWidget{modeRb(&rbgroup, "16-Color"), subFlow},
		&gowid.ContainerWidget{modeRb(&rbgroup, "88-Color"), subFlow},
		&gowid.ContainerWidget{cols256, subFlow},
	})

	pw2 := pile.New([]gowid.IContainerWidget{
		&gowid.ContainerWidget{modeRb(&bggroup, "Foreground Colors"), subFlow},
		&gowid.ContainerWidget{modeRb(&bggroup, "Background Colors"), subFlow},
		&gowid.ContainerWidget{divider.NewBlank(), subFlow},
		&gowid.ContainerWidget{divider.NewBlank(), subFlow},
		&gowid.ContainerWidget{
			styled.NewExt(
				btn,
				gowid.MakePaletteRef("panel"),
				gowid.MakePaletteRef("focus"),
			),
			subFlow},
	})

	cs := columns.New([]gowid.IContainerWidget{
		&gowid.ContainerWidget{pw1, gowid.RenderWithWeight{10}},
		&gowid.ContainerWidget{pw2, gowid.RenderWithWeight{10}},
	})

	cs2 := styled.New(cs, gowid.MakePaletteRef("panel"))

	chart256Content = text.NewFromContent(parseChart(chart256))
	chartHolder = holder.New(chart256Content)

	view := pile.New([]gowid.IContainerWidget{
		&gowid.ContainerWidget{headerText, subFlow},
		&gowid.ContainerWidget{cs2, subFlow},
		&gowid.ContainerWidget{chartHolder, gowid.RenderWithWeight{1}},
	})

	app, err := gowid.NewApp(gowid.AppArgs{
		View:    view,
		Palette: &palette,
		Log:     log.StandardLogger(),
	})
	examples.ExitOnErr(err)
	app.SetColorMode(gowid.Mode256Colors)

	app.SimpleMainLoop()
}
